The GM Heritage Center has a lot of unpublished info on Pontiacs, but unfortunately no info on 1966 Pontiacs like this - a shame.

However, I have seen their 1967 numbers (which are for the 421's replacement, the 428) and it's interesting to note that the top engines were more popular on the Bonneville than the Catalina, 2+2 excepted. Prob is analogous to the number of L-36 427 Caprices you see versus basic Impalas, Bel Airs, and Biscaynes (at least from my observation).
